学习笔记
WenJing7
这个作者很懒,什么都没留下…
展开
-
Java并发
Java并发 CopyOnWriteArrayList详解 1、 CopyOnWriteArrayList(写数组的拷贝)是ArrayList的一个线程安全的变体,CopyOnWriteArrayList和CopyOnWriteSet都是线程安全的集合,其中所有可变操作(add、set等等)都是通过对底层数组进行一次新的复制来实现的。 2、它绝对不会抛出ConcurrentModific...原创 2018-06-05 20:35:24 · 175 阅读 · 0 评论 -
学习笔记 | Java虚拟机
类加载机制 类加载的过程 类加载的过程包括了加载、验证、准备、解析、初始化五个阶段 在这五个阶段中,加载、验证、准备和初始化这四个阶段发生的顺序是确定的,而解析阶段则不一定,它在某些情况下可以在初始化阶段之后开始,这是为了支持Java语言的运行时绑定(也成为动态绑定或晚期绑定)。另外注意这里的几个阶段是按顺序开始,而不是按顺序进行或完成,因为这些阶段通常都是互相交叉地混合进行的,通常在一个阶...原创 2018-06-05 20:58:51 · 277 阅读 · 0 评论